The following question consist of two statements, one labelled as the 'Assertion (A)' and the other as 'Reason (R)'. Youare to examine these twostatements carefully and select the answer. Assertion (A): Ifevents, $A, B, C, D$ are mutually exhaustive,
then $(\mathrm{A} \cup \mathrm{B} \cup \mathrm{C})^{\mathrm{C}}=\mathrm{D}$.
Reason $(\mathbf{R}):(\mathrm{A} \cup \mathrm{B} \cup \mathrm{C})^{\mathrm{C}}=\mathrm{D}$.implies if any element is
excluded from the sets $\mathrm{A}, \mathrm{B}$ and $\mathrm{C}$, then it is included in $\mathrm{D}$.
MathematicsSets and RelationsNDANDA 2007 (Phase 2)
Options:
  • A Both Aand $\mathbf{R}$ are individually true, and $\mathbf{R}$ is the correct explanation of $\mathbf{A}$
  • B Both $\mathbf{A}$ and $\mathbf{R}$ are individually true but $\mathbf{R}$ is not the correct explanation of $\mathbf{A}$.
  • C $\mathbf{A}$ is true but $\mathbf{R}$ is false.
  • D A is false but $\mathbf{R}$ is true.
Solution:
2534 Upvotes Verified Answer
The correct answer is: Both Aand $\mathbf{R}$ are individually true, and $\mathbf{R}$ is the correct explanation of $\mathbf{A}$
Both (A) and (R) are true and $R$ is the correct explanation of A.
